Understanding DMA Cards: Options, Apps, and Best TechniquesKnowing DMA Playing cards: Characteristics, Benefits, and the way to Choose the Ideal A singleUnderstanding DMA Playing cards: Attributes, Added benefits, and How to Pick the Proper A person

Introduction to DMA Cards
While in the realm of computing, efficiency is paramount. Components answers such as dma card are with the forefront of optimizing data transfer premiums, freeing up the CPU, and boosting General process efficiency. Immediate Memory Accessibility (DMA) technological know-how streamlines how info is managed within computing programs, offering myriad Positive aspects for various apps—ranging from gaming and data Examination to multimedia processing.

What is a DMA Card?
A DMA card can be a specialised hardware ingredient that enables immediate access to a pc’s memory without the CPU’s intervention. Usually, details transfer processes concerning peripherals (like difficult drives, graphics playing cards, and network interfaces) and RAM call for CPU resources, which might build bottlenecks. DMA cards reduce this burden by making a focused pathway for info stream, permitting devices to perform a number of responsibilities much more successfully.

How DMA Cards Perform
DMA playing cards operate by way of a DMA controller embedded throughout the card itself. This controller manages the memory transactions by right accessing the system’s memory bus, prioritizing facts transfer requests from various units. When a tool must ship or acquire information, it indicators the DMA controller, which usually takes more than by transferring the information instantly in between the system and memory. This method not just lowers the CPU’s workload but will also raises the pace and trustworthiness of data transfers.

Frequent Apps of DMA Cards
DMA cards are adaptable and they are utilized in different fields, which include:

Gaming: In gaming, DMA cards have acquired notoriety for enabling Innovative cheat systems. By permitting actual-time use of activity memory, players can modify recreation facts on-the-fly for Increased gameplay encounters.
Knowledge Assessment: Data scientists use DMA playing cards for heavy computational duties, drastically rushing up details processing workflows.
Multimedia Processing: Experts in video clip enhancing and streaming leverage DMA playing cards to facilitate higher-pace facts transfer concerning storage devices and editing application, boosting workflow performance.
Benefits of Utilizing DMA Cards
Improved Effectiveness and Efficiency
Certainly one of the principal great things about employing DMA playing cards is the exceptional enhancement in knowledge transfer performance. By enabling equipment to read or create to memory independently from your CPU, Total technique effectiveness is Increased. This is particularly beneficial in higher-load situations including gaming or massive facts processing tasks, exactly where each and every millisecond counts.

Lowered CPU Overhead
With DMA playing cards dealing with facts transfer obligations, CPU means is usually allotted to other high-priority tasks. This reduction in overhead not just improves responsiveness across programs but in addition Positive aspects multitasking environments the place a number of procedures contend for CPU awareness.

Enhanced Facts Transfer Premiums
DMA technological know-how permits A great deal higher data transfer rates than traditional methods, making it ideal for applications requiring rapid data movement. For instance, in data-intensive purposes like online video enhancing, a chance to shift substantial data files quickly devoid of CPU involvement can help save time and greatly enhance efficiency.

Deciding on the Ideal DMA Card
Vital Capabilities to take into consideration
When picking out a DMA card, it’s important to take into consideration many essential characteristics that align with your specific requires:

Compatibility: Make sure the DMA card is appropriate with the motherboard along with the working program. Verify interfaces like PCIe or USB to guarantee seamless integration.
Performance Metrics: Try to look for playing cards with requirements that satisfy your efficiency expectations regarding details transfer premiums and latency.
Model Popularity: Pick set up brands which provide robust customer assistance and warranty solutions, cutting down likely hazards related to components failures.
Evaluating Diverse Brand names and Designs
Manufacturer name can drastically affect the quality and reliability of DMA cards. Well known types usually consist of Those people from suppliers like Lambda Principle and FPGA primarily based solutions, which might be renowned for his or her balance and performance. It’s highly recommended to read through user reviews and Qualified evaluations to assess how various products stack up from each read more here other.

Price Ranges and Budgeting
DMA card selling prices can assortment widely, from spending plan possibilities about $thirty to substantial-stop models exceeding $two hundred. When budgeting for any DMA card, consider not simply the upfront Expense but also the probable efficiency benefits it could possibly carry to your functions. Investing in the next-good quality card can lead to major productiveness gains and longer-expression financial savings.

Set up and Setup of DMA Cards
Move-by-Phase Installation Tutorial
Setting up a DMA card is a simple process, nonetheless it requires a thorough strategy:

Power Down Your Computer system: Before starting, be certain your Personal computer is totally driven off and unplugged from any electrical sources.
Open up the Computer Scenario: Eliminate the facet panel of one's Computer system making use of the right equipment, usually a screwdriver.
Track down an Empty Slot: Discover an available PCIe slot on your own motherboard exactly where the DMA card might be inserted.
Insert the DMA Card: Align the connector of the card While using the slot and gently force it in till it’s securely equipped.
Near the situation: Substitute the facet panel of one's Laptop or computer and link any ability cables.
Boot Your Personal computer: Ability in your process and install any needed drivers or application that may be necessary with the DMA card to function effectively.
Troubleshooting Typical Difficulties
Despite the simplicity on the installation approach, challenges can come up, for instance:

Card Not Detected: Check out connections and ensure the card is seated effectively during the PCIe slot.
Driver Problems: Make sure you have the latest drivers mounted for the card through the company’s Web site.
Incompatibility: In case the DMA card is not acknowledged, validate that it is suitable with all your technique’s technical specs.
Computer software and Driver Necessities
After installation, setting up the necessary drivers is important for exceptional card overall performance. Quite a few brands supply driver offers that can be downloaded from their Internet sites. Assure these motorists are frequently up-to-date to take care of compatibility with system updates and patches.

Potential Tendencies in DMA Technological know-how
Innovations in Knowledge Transfer
The way forward for DMA technologies appears promising, with ongoing improvements directed at additional bettering velocity and performance. Emerging developments include things like the event of quicker memory technologies, that can possible increase the information transfer costs achievable by DMA interfaces. The mixing of machine Understanding algorithms may additionally enrich how DMA manages data flows and prioritizes method assets.

Likely Current market Changes
Because the need for prime-effectiveness computing improves across industries, additional gamers are entering the DMA marketplace, leading to better Competitiveness and innovation. This evolution is predicted to prompt decreases in pricing and enhancements in features and compatibility.

Impact on Computing Overall performance
The continued development of DMA technological innovation will certainly greatly enhance computing performance across numerous sectors, such as cloud computing, gaming, and info processing. Firms and men and women eager on leveraging the most up-to-date in DMA technological know-how for aggressive gain will need to stay updated on trends and developments to create informed buying choices.

Leave a Reply

Your email address will not be published. Required fields are marked *